Alice's book has 200 Pages. Alice has read 75% of the pages in her book. Nina has read the same number of pages the only 50% of

the pages in her book how many pages are in Nina's book? explaine.

Alice has read 150 pages, you would multiple 200 by .75 (75%). If Nina had read 50% of her book and she read 150, you multiple by 2, and get 300. So Nina has 300 pages in her book.

The difference of the squares of two positive consecutive even integers is 84. Find the integers.
ziro4ka [17]

Answer:

The two integers are 20 and 22.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x be the first integer.

(x+2)^{2}-x^{2} = 84\\x^{2} +4x+4-x^{2} = 84\\4x = 80\\x = 20
